
There are those occasions when you just want to look your skinniest. Somehow, feeling tucked in and bolted down is a form of armor against your approaching 30th reunion or a big meeting. So "Good Morning America" joined with Real Simple magazine and tried out new garments and devices -- rating them on a scale of 1 to 10 -- that promise to suck you in and help you hold it all together.
MMK Brands Thong
Stay Put Factor: 7
Comfort Level: 6
Slim Factor: 6
Review: This pair of underwear has a thong strap and standard front panel, but instead of a string top across the back and tummy, the MMK comes with a 6-inch-high control top.
This product garnered mixed reviews: One person found the thong very comfortable and a good solution to muffin top as it compressed the abdomen area. The other tester liked the smoothing control at the hip but found that the control top rolled down frequently. One complaint was that the garment created a bulge at the waist, basically pushing the muffin top up to the waistline.
MMK also makes a standard nonthong version that gives full coverage to the backside.
Yummie Tummie Tank
Stay Put Factor: 6
Comfort Level: 9
Slim Factor: 7
Review: This may look like a regular cotton tank top but it is actually very fitting in the midsection. It tightens the stomach and smooths the transition from the jeans to the hips. We liked the style because it reflects the trend of letting a camisole peek out from under a shirt with jeans. But the tank did not always stay put and, occasionally, the tight middle panel rode up above the pants' waist line, exacerbating the muffin top. But, overall,we thought it was a stylish, comfortable and slimming solution. Yummie Tummie also makes a T-shirt version for men called RIPT Fusion.
